unity3d物体移动代码

作者&投稿:利刘 (若有异议请与网页底部的电邮联系)

unity3d快捷键_unity3d快捷键大全
Unity编辑器中的移动、旋转、缩放可以基于pivot或者center,在按钮栏上选中哪种就基于哪种。unity全屏快捷键 打开unity3d,然后点击设置就能取消视图最大化 unity3d常用快捷键 1\/5如果需要同时选中所有物体,可以使用快捷键Ctrl+A 2\/5要取消全选的话使用快捷键Shift+D即可 3\/5如果需要选择物体的所有子物体...

【Unity3D】Transform组件
实现背景展示。最后,为每个模型添加特定的Script组件,如Sun.cs、Earth.cs和Moon.cs,以实现各自的动作。通过脚本,太阳、地球、月球在模拟中相互绕转与自转,展现动态效果。此过程通过Unity的图形界面与脚本实现,展示了Transform组件在场景中的应用。本文转自【Unity3D】Transform组件。

关于Unity3D 这是控制主角移动和规定边界的一段代码,请问为什么不按按键...
假设你这个2D游戏用的是X-Y平面,而且前面你通过水平和垂直偏移(键盘或手柄)的计算速度向量的过程都是按X-Y平面做的,可是为什么到最后一句用钳位计算实际位置的时候,用的是X-Z平面?问题就出现在这里,我粗略的写:你的是:position=new Vector3(Clamp(x轴位置和边界), 0, Clamp(y轴位置和边界...

unity3D 一物体跟着另一物体运动
follow.transform.parent = lead.transform

如何让Unity3D Mecanim动画系统Generic动画支持动画中的位移
导入Unity之后,指定好动画骨骼的根节点,创建Animator Controller之后,把动作设置好,点击Play按钮,即可。

如何利用UNITY3D中展示一件物品模型(旋转 缩放 平移)
写脚本实现

unity3D基础入门教程?
在场景视图中操纵并修改物体是Unity非常重要的功能。这是昀好的通过设计者而不是玩家的角度来查看场景的方法。在场景视图中你可以随意移动并操纵物体,但是你应该知道一些基本的命令以便有效的使用场景视图。第一个你应该知道命令是FrameSelected命令。这个命令将居中显示你当前选中的物体。你可以在层次视图(...

如何在Unity3d中拖拽任意的对象
任意拖拽游戏对象通常有2种实现方式 针对UGUI,这个你需要实现IBeginDragHandler, IDragHandler, IEndDragHandler 三个接口,并且实现上述三个方法.IBeginDragHandler:开始拖拽时 IDragHandler:拖拽中 IEndDragHandler 拖拽结束 如果是针对一般的模型,那么你首先需要定义射线,其次需要对拖拽的物体添加碰撞器。

unity3d 去掉骨骼位移
在动画面板里修改这个骨骼动画的z轴移动,或者在3dmax里弄。

【Unity3D问题】请问这段C#平移的脚本,用JS语音怎么写
pragma strict public var movespeed:float = 3.0;function Update () { var speed:Vector3 = Vector3(0,0,-movespeed);var rigidbody = this.GetComponent(Rigidbody);rigidbody.velocity = speed;}

帅罡15326465311问: unity3d中如何让物体从一个点自动移动到另一个点 -
关岭布依族苗族自治县思可回答: function update () { transform.position = vector3(mathf.lerp(minimum, maximum, time.time), 0, 0); } lerp 就可以了 minimum 是你起始点, max是你到的点 你可以把 x y z 都换成 lerp transform.position = vector3(mathf.lerp(minimum, maximum, time....

帅罡15326465311问: Unity3D中如何用代码实现物体的左右循环移动 最好是C# JS也可以 初学者 希望详细代码 谢谢啊 -
关岭布依族苗族自治县思可回答: 1、新建一个Cube,在Cube X轴的正方向放置一个空物体或者其他GameObject,Cube和空物体的Y值一致,确保2者在同一水平线上;2、把下列代码保存为C#,赋给Cube,并在Inspector视图中,把空物体赋到脚本的PointB中;using ...

帅罡15326465311问: Unity物体之间保持距离移动的代码 -
关岭布依族苗族自治县思可回答: 当一个物体距离另一个物体大于1时,此物体就不运动 if(Vector3.Distance(other.position,transform.position)>1) { 这里写控制物体移动的代码 }

帅罡15326465311问: unity 让物体在一个平面上随机移动 要怎么做呢 求简单的示范代码 -
关岭布依族苗族自治县思可回答: 对着物体操作处按下鼠标左键并按住, 然后拖动鼠标

帅罡15326465311问: unity3D如何实现物体跟随相机移动 -
关岭布依族苗族自治县思可回答: 新建一个空物体,把小球放在空物体下面,摄像机跟随空物体移动

帅罡15326465311问: unity3d加速移动代码 -
关岭布依族苗族自治县思可回答: unity3d加速移动代码是; 1.MoveSpeed += Time.deltaTime. 2.transform.Translate(MoveSpeed*Vector3.forward,Space.Self).Unity3D: Unity3D是由Unity Technologies开发的一个让玩家轻松创建诸如三维视频游戏、建筑可视化、实时三维动画等类型互动内容的多平台的综合型游戏开发工具,是一个全面整合的专业游戏引擎.Unity类似于Director,Blender game engine, Virtools 或 Torque Game Builder等利用交互的图型化开发环境为首要方式的软件.

帅罡15326465311问: unity里怎么让一个物体在在5秒内从某点移动到另外一点? -
关岭布依族苗族自治县思可回答: 解决方法: 已知两点距离与所用时间,可以得出速度值,然后以这个速度值往目标方向移动.this.transform.Translate(Vector3.normalize(目标位置-自身位置) * (Vector3.Distance(自身位置, 目标位置)/(所用时间 * Time.deltime)));Unity...

帅罡15326465311问: unity中怎么让物体随着鼠标移动? -
关岭布依族苗族自治县思可回答: unity让物体随着鼠标移动来的方法: transform.position = Camera.main.ScreenToWorldPoint(Input.mousePosition + new Vector3(0, 0, Camera.main.farClipPlane));拓展:在unity3d中用鼠标移动物体控制每步移动的距离的相关理解步骤: ...

帅罡15326465311问: 在unity3d中要实现点击按钮物体会上下移动应当怎样设置C#代码 -
关岭布依族苗族自治县思可回答: MoveGameObject.transform.rotation = Quaternion.RotateTowards(transform.rotation, Terget.rotation,Time.deltaTime*speed); 或者 float posx = Mathf.Clamp(transform.position.x,1f,3f); transform.position = new Vector3(posx,transform.pos.y,transform.position.z);

帅罡15326465311问: unity3d中如何用代码实现方块的左右移动 且人物站在上面可以跟着移动 跪求
关岭布依族苗族自治县思可回答: 1、 利用层级关系,触碰时,方块是角色的父级,离开解除关系 void OnCollisionStay(Collision other) { other.gameObject.transform.parent = transform; } void OnCollisionExit(Collision other) { other.gameObject.transform.parent = null; } 2、利用位移...


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网